Things to do near
Hebron, Maine

  • Naples Causeway - Just 20 miles from Hebron, ME, this scenic area offers beautiful views of Long Lake and Brandy Pond. It's a great spot for walking, dining, and enjoying water activities.

  • Sabbathday Lake Shaker Village - Located about 22 miles away in New Gloucester, ME, this is the only active Shaker community in the world. Visitors can explore the museum and learn about Shaker history and culture.

  • Pineland Farms - Approximately 25 miles from Hebron in New Gloucester, ME. This working farm offers trails for hiking and biking as well as educational programs on agriculture.

  • Thorncrag Bird Sanctuary - Situated around 30 miles away in Lewiston, ME. This sanctuary provides a peaceful setting for bird watching with several trails through diverse habitats.

  • Range Ponds State Park - About 35 miles from Hebron in Poland Spring, ME. The park features sandy beaches on Lower Range Pond perfect for swimming or picnicking with family.

  • Maine Wildlife Park - Located roughly 40 miles away in Gray, ME. This park is home to over thirty species of native wildlife that cannot be released back into the wild due to injury or human imprinting.

  • Bradbury Mountain State Park - Around 45 miles from Hebron near Pownal, ME. Known for its panoramic views at the summit which are accessible via several hiking trails suitable for all skill levels.

Frequently Asked Questions

You can find grocery stores and markets in nearby Freeport, including Shaws, Bowstreet Market, Hannafords, and Walmart.

The Amtrak Downeaster provides train service from Brunswick to Boston.

You can visit several breweries in the Freeport area such as Maine Beer Company and Stars and Stripes Brewing Company.

Aquaboggan Waterpark is one of the recommended waterparks located within driving distance from Hebron.

The Maine Wildlife Park in Gray offers an opportunity to view various wildlife species up close.

Old Fort Western in Augusta is a notable historical site that offers insights into America's past with its preserved wooden fort structure.
